If you’re in search of an identity and access management system without breaking the bank, Keycloak might be the solution for you. Keycloak is an open-source identity and access management software that offers a range of features to help manage user authentication and authorization efficiently.



Key Features of Keycloak

Keycloak provides several key features that make it a popular choice among professionals:

  • Single Sign-On (SSO) Solution: Allows users to log in to multiple applications using a single set of credentials.
  • Support for Multiple Protocols: Supports protocols such as OpenID Connect, OAuth 2.0, and SAML 2.0 for seamless integration with various applications.
  • Centralized Management: Offers centralized management for administrators and users, simplifying user authentication and access control.
  • Social Login: Enables users to log in using social media accounts via OpenID Connect or SAML 2.0.
  • Scalability and Performance: High-performance, lightweight, and scalable, with clustering features for scalability, performance, and high availability.
  • Customization: Provides built-in themes and customization options to tailor the look and feel of the authentication process to meet specific requirements or branding needs.
  • Password Policies and Multi-Tenancy: Supports various password policies and allows for the creation of a multi-tenant environment.

Installation and Configuration

Installing Keycloak, especially with Docker, is straightforward:

  • Docker Installation: Simply copy and paste the provided Docker command, customize the user ID and password, and access the admin console to configure realms, users, and applications.
  • Server Guide: For production environments, it’s recommended to configure a database like PostgreSQL and SSL certificates. The server guide provides detailed instructions for configuration.
